What Is O3 Swap and Why Does It Matter?

O3 Swap is not a standalone exchange. Think of it as a router for your crypto assets. Developed by O3 Labs, it aggregates liquidity from multiple decentralized exchanges (DEXs). When you swap tokens on O3 Swap, the system automatically finds the best price across several networks, saving you time and slippage fees.

The platform supports heterogeneous blockchain networks. This means it doesn’t stick to just one chain. It bridges the gap between:

  • Ethereum (ETH)
  • Binance Smart Chain (BSC)
  • NEO Blockchain
  • Huobi ECO Chain (HECO)

This multi-chain approach was revolutionary when it launched. Most competitors were stuck on Ethereum alone, dealing with high gas fees. O3 Swap offered a way to access cheaper transactions on BSC or HECO while still maintaining security standards similar to ETH. For users, this meant broader asset accessibility without needing separate wallets for every single chain.

The History of O3 Swap Airdrops

To know what’s available now, we have to look at what happened before. The O3 Swap airdrop history gives us clues about how the team rewards users. There were two major phases that defined the project’s early growth.

The 2021 Beta Testing Campaign

Between April 25 and May 10, 2021, O3 Labs ran its most significant community-driven airdrop. This wasn’t a passive giveaway. They wanted testers. Participants had to connect their wallets-specifically MetaMask or O3 Wallet-and complete at least one transaction across three core modules:

  1. Swap: Exchanging one token for another.
  2. Hub: Moving assets between chains.
  3. Liquidity Provision: Adding funds to trading pairs.

The goal was stress-testing the bridge mechanisms. Users who completed these tasks received O3 tokens. The exact amount per user wasn’t fixed publicly, but the emphasis was on genuine usage. If you just connected and did nothing, you got nothing. This set a precedent: O3 Labs rewards activity, not just presence.

The CoinMarketCap Partnership

Later, O3 Swap partnered with CoinMarketCap for a more traditional social-media-focused campaign. The prize pool totaled 10,245 O3 tokens, split among 500 winners. Each winner could receive up to 20.49 O3 tokens. The requirements were stricter:

  • Follow @O3_Labs on Twitter.
  • Retweet the announcement and tag two friends.
  • Join the official Telegram group.
  • Subscribe to the Medium publication.
  • Provide a valid HECO (HRC-20) wallet address.

Note the HECO requirement. This pushed users toward the Huobi ecosystem, likely to boost volume on that specific chain. Also, the tokens came with lock-up mechanisms. You couldn’t sell them immediately; you had to unlock them according to protocol guidelines. This prevented instant dumping and encouraged long-term holding.

Technical Architecture: Why O3 Swap Stands Out

Why should you care about O3 Swap beyond the free tokens? Because the technology solves a real problem: fragmentation. In DeFi, liquidity is scattered. On Uniswap, it’s deep for ETH pairs. On PancakeSwap, it’s great for BSC. On Swappi, it’s optimized for NEO. Moving between them is tedious and expensive.

O3 Swap acts as an aggregator. It queries all these sources simultaneously. When you initiate a swap, the smart contract executes the trade on the DEX offering the best rate. This reduces slippage-the difference between the expected price and the executed price. For large trades, this can save hundreds of dollars.

The cross-chain hub is particularly interesting. It allows you to move assets from Ethereum to HECO without selling them for stablecoins first. You keep your native assets while changing networks. This functionality relies on secure bridge mechanisms, which have been tested extensively since the 2021 beta.

Risks and Considerations

No DeFi project is risk-free. Before diving in, consider these factors:

  • Smart Contract Risk: Like any protocol, bugs can exist. While O3 Swap has undergone audits, always start with small amounts.
  • Bridge Security: Cross-chain bridges are frequent targets for hackers. Monitor news for any security incidents involving the underlying bridges.
  • Token Volatility: O3 tokens can be volatile. Lock-up periods mean you might miss the chance to sell during a pump.
  • Regulatory Changes: As crypto regulations tighten globally, ensure you comply with local laws regarding token acquisitions and staking.

Do your own research (DYOR). Don’t invest based solely on airdrop potential. Evaluate the utility of the platform itself.
